Overview
- In The Athletic’s anonymous poll of 76 players, 64 (84.2%) said they are OK with Brady serving as both a Raiders minority owner and Fox analyst.
- Five players opposed the arrangement and seven said they didn’t know or didn’t care.
- Supporters frequently pointed to Brady’s legacy, with some noting Las Vegas finished 3–14 in 2025 when dismissing competitive concerns.
- A smaller group warned of conflict-of-interest risks and poor optics from overlapping owner and broadcaster access.
- The NFL barred Brady from in-person production meetings in 2024 before allowing virtual participation last season, following scrutiny over his presence in the Raiders’ coaching box and broadcasts scheduled shortly before teams faced Las Vegas.
